Voglibose & Metformin Tablet

Packing Available

Tablet Presentation

Each Uncoated tablets contains:

Voglibose JP         0.2/0.3 mg
Metformin IP       500 mg

Voglibose is the oral antidiabetic drug used for the treatment type 2 diabetes mellitus .it is alpha - glucosidase inhibitor that is used to lower the sugar level in the blood in case of diabetic patients .Complex carbohydrates are converted into simple sugars (monosaccharide’s) which can be easily absorbed from the intestine. Therefore alpha glucosidase inhibitors reduces the impact of complex carbohydrates

Metformin belongs to the class of biguanids and used in the management of the type 2 diabetes mellitus. Metformin is the insulin sensitizer and reduces the insulin resistance. Metformin is beneficial in obese patients This combination together use to control the blood glucose level

Mechanism of Action

Alpha- glucosidase inhibitors act as competitive inhibitors of enzymes which are present on the Border of small intestine needed to digest carbohydrates. The alpha-glucosidase undergoes Hydrolysis of oligosaccharides, trisaccharides, and disaccharides to produce glucose .the other alpha glucosidase inhibitor such as Acarbose, blocks pancreatic alpha-amylase and inhibiting alpha-glucosidases as well. Inhibition of these enzyme helps to reduces the rate of digestion of complex carbohydrates so that the lesser amount of glucose is absorbed Metformin prevents the hepatic glucose production, increases the intestinal absorption of the glucose and inhibit peripheral utilization of the glucose

Side Effects

  • Diarrhea
  • Flatulence
  • Bloating
  • Nausea
  • Abdominal cramps
  • Increases the level of liver enzymes
  • upper respiratory tract infection
  • Lactic acidosis

Contraindication

  • Contraindicated in patients with inflammatory bowel disease
  • Contraindicated in pregnancy
  • Contraindicated in patients with liver failure
